During the next 5 days, the nation’s most significant storm system will develop near the middle Atlantic Coast late Friday before passing close to the New England coastline on Saturday. Significant, wind-driven snow should accumulate along and near the northern half of the Atlantic Coast. Meanwhile, a new surge of cold air will sweep across the Midwestern and Northeastern States. By Sunday morning, January 30, near-freezing temperatures may occur as far south as interior southern Florida.
